Croatia Consulting on Draft Bill to Increase VAT Threshold, Introduce EU Small Business Scheme, and Expand Access to VAT Refunds for Non-EU Businesses

|Proposed Changes|Croatia
Croatia

Croatia's Ministry of Finance has launched a public consultation on a draft bill amending the VAT Act. One of the main measures of the bill is an increase in the VAT registration threshold from EUR 40,000 to EUR 50,000. In connection with this, the draft bill also introduces measures for the EU small business scheme for cross-border supplies.
